Conclusion
Daiwa 20 Ballistic EX LT 4000D-CX clearly outshines Daiwa RX LT 2000X, offering significantly better performance in total score (9.1 out of 10) and maximum drag (12kg / 26,46lbs). While Daiwa RX LT 2000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 20 Ballistic EX LT 4000D-CX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
